What You’ll Do

Build smart plans

Contribute to the development of cross‑channel media strategies for both traditional and digital channels (TV, radio, digital, social, influencer, search, outdoor, print, etc.).

Work with your team to analyze competitive landscape, consumer insights, historical performance and develop rationale for media plan recommendations and strategic use of channels.

Evaluate media proposals from partners and provide POVs to clients.

Bring them into the world

Work with Platforms and In‑house Programmatic teams to execute media plans promptly and accurately. Provide ongoing stewardship and execution of plans, including:

Managing publisher RFPs.

Contributing to insertion order process and ensuring adherence to agency terms & conditions.

Trafficking digital and traditional campaigns.

Monitoring campaign deliveries, pacing and suggesting optimizations based on campaign KPI performance.

Monitoring client expenditures and working with various teams to resolve billing discrepancies.

Become a go‑to media expert

Contribute to our always‑on trend spotting to establish a strong thought leadership position with clients in an ever‑changing media landscape.

Collaborate within the agency to share best in class work and inspire upcoming briefs/plans.

Be curious about media, and finding unique, efficient and effective solutions for clients.

What You Need To Succeed
Grit: ask the tough questions, always know the “why”, not just the “what”.

Agility: we’re more nimble than ever, and we’re looking for another pace setter.

Straight talk: we already have enough jargon.

Accountability: find the delicate balance of agility, quality of output, and impact to the business.

Minimum 1 year of media planning experience, agency environment preferred.

Digital experience required, traditional experience bonus.

Knowledge of research tools like ComScore, Simmons/MRI, MediaOcean, Kantar, Prisma etc.

Working knowledge of asset trafficking to ensure accuracy and create reasonable timelines and expectations for deliverables.

Basic understanding of site tagging and analytics platforms like Adobe and Google Analytics.

Ability to write clear and concise presentations in straight‑forward and enlightening way.

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ously in a fast‑paced environment.

Ability to identify and initiate the first steps in the process and see them through to the end of a project.
